Discovery+ tennis viewing interrupted

When watching some replays ie the Djokovic match there is a line of tennis balls across the screen, kinda like a watermark on documents. 

Anyone have any ideas as to why or how I can remove it?

That is the timeline function that selects points of interest through the match, like winn8ng interview, set points, break points etc.

It is shown on replays and when using the Watch from Start, during a live match.

 

When playing the match, just hit the dismiss key on your Sky remote.

Make sure that you have dropped down to the pause/playff/rew bar, below the timeline, when doing dismiss, otherwise you may drop out of the match.

Discovery have beeen doing it like this with some of their other Sports for sometime, it's not unique to the Tennis.

They seem to be there to watch hot shots, break points etc. They were annoying me too but I found a way to turn them off by pressing on the rectangle with three balls on the right hand side of the screen.
